onlyFE is looking for a Programme Leader in Electrical Installation to join the Grimsby Institute. This role involves planning engaging lessons and supporting students through their journey.

The ideal candidate should possess:

  • A Level 3 Electrical Installation qualification
  • A Level 2 GCSE in English and Maths
  • A teaching qualification

Additional benefits include 40 days annual leave and a pension scheme. The position is permanent and part-time, at 18.5 hours per week. Interested candidates should apply by May 4, 2026.
